Output 8d882d2b8f3aabba5d6899b84238793bf596c6a7c1ae401296db2b32d7a7ead8:0

value
20578900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d1ddb55dd0703a5cf30b63e719b80610f2c795 OP_EQUAL
address
A66SkinGdi5N6BGw4chgVeUejFq1honmcY
transaction
8d882d2b8f3aabba5d6899b84238793bf596c6a7c1ae401296db2b32d7a7ead8